Unit comes equipped with a battery that
requires no regular maintenance except
cleaning the terminals.
Remove Battery
1. Shut off engine. Engage parking brake.
Remove the ignition key.
2. Place seat in the service position (See
Service Position on page 27).
3. Disconnect cables from battery (negative,
then positive) (Figure 23).
4. Remove hold down bracket and remove
battery.
Replace Battery
1. Replace battery and secure with hold
down bracket.
2. Reconnect cables to battery (positive,
then negative). Position boot over
positive terminal.
3. Return seat to operating position.
Clean Battery
Keep battery and terminals clean. Inspect
every 100 operating hours or monthly for best
performance.

1. Remove battery from unit.
2. Clean terminals and battery cable ends
with wire brush.
3. Coat terminals with dielectric grease or
petroleum jelly.
4. Replace battery.
Charging the Battery
IMPORTANT: DO NOT fast charge. Charging
at a higher rate will damage or destroy
battery. ONLY use an automatic charger
designed for use with your battery.
ALWAYS follow information provided on
battery by battery manufacturer. Contact
battery manufacturer for extensive
instructions to charge battery.
1. Remove battery from unit. See Remove
Battery on page 33.
2. Place battery on bench or other well-
ventilated place.
3. Connect positive (+) lead of charger to
positive (+) terminal, and negative (–)
lead to negative (–) terminal.
4. Charge battery according to charger and
battery manufacturers' instructions.
5. Replace battery. See Replace Battery on
page 33.
Jump-Starting
Gravely does not recommend jump-starting
your unit. Jump-starting can damage engine
and electrical system components. See your
engine manual for more detailed information.
